Skip to content

Commit 09b31bd

Browse files
feat: publish new fields to support cluster group routing (#958)
This PR was generated using Autosynth. 🌈 Synth log will be available here: https://source.cloud.google.com/results/invocations/795b11d4-0f7a-417c-9125-5c8d74383ee1/targets - [ ] To automatically regenerate this PR, check this box. (May take up to 24 hours.) PiperOrigin-RevId: 391576441 Source-Link: googleapis/googleapis@5f76113 PiperOrigin-RevId: 391407209 Source-Link: googleapis/googleapis@e1738ee
1 parent 10fd041 commit 09b31bd

File tree

7 files changed

+390
-28
lines changed

7 files changed

+390
-28
lines changed

google-cloud-bigtable/src/main/java/com/google/cloud/bigtable/admin/v2/stub/BigtableInstanceAdminStubSettings.java

+3-1
Original file line numberDiff line numberDiff line change
@@ -388,7 +388,9 @@ public static List<String> getDefaultServiceScopes() {
388388

389389
/** Returns a builder for the default credentials for this service. */
390390
public static GoogleCredentialsProvider.Builder defaultCredentialsProviderBuilder() {
391-
return GoogleCredentialsProvider.newBuilder().setScopesToApply(DEFAULT_SERVICE_SCOPES);
391+
return GoogleCredentialsProvider.newBuilder()
392+
.setScopesToApply(DEFAULT_SERVICE_SCOPES)
393+
.setUseJwtAccessWithScope(true);
392394
}
393395

394396
/** Returns a builder for the default ChannelProvider for this service. */

google-cloud-bigtable/src/main/java/com/google/cloud/bigtable/admin/v2/stub/BigtableTableAdminStubSettings.java

+3-1
Original file line numberDiff line numberDiff line change
@@ -514,7 +514,9 @@ public static List<String> getDefaultServiceScopes() {
514514

515515
/** Returns a builder for the default credentials for this service. */
516516
public static GoogleCredentialsProvider.Builder defaultCredentialsProviderBuilder() {
517-
return GoogleCredentialsProvider.newBuilder().setScopesToApply(DEFAULT_SERVICE_SCOPES);
517+
return GoogleCredentialsProvider.newBuilder()
518+
.setScopesToApply(DEFAULT_SERVICE_SCOPES)
519+
.setUseJwtAccessWithScope(true);
518520
}
519521

520522
/** Returns a builder for the default ChannelProvider for this service. */

google-cloud-bigtable/src/main/java/com/google/cloud/bigtable/data/v2/stub/BigtableStubSettings.java

+3-1
Original file line numberDiff line numberDiff line change
@@ -148,7 +148,9 @@ public static List<String> getDefaultServiceScopes() {
148148

149149
/** Returns a builder for the default credentials for this service. */
150150
public static GoogleCredentialsProvider.Builder defaultCredentialsProviderBuilder() {
151-
return GoogleCredentialsProvider.newBuilder().setScopesToApply(DEFAULT_SERVICE_SCOPES);
151+
return GoogleCredentialsProvider.newBuilder()
152+
.setScopesToApply(DEFAULT_SERVICE_SCOPES)
153+
.setUseJwtAccessWithScope(true);
152154
}
153155

154156
/** Returns a builder for the default ChannelProvider for this service. */

0 commit comments

Comments
 (0)